Improve robustness of final file detection after download
Enhanced the logic for finding the final downloaded file by always searching for the most recent video or audio file in the download directory and its subdirectories. This approach handles various post-processing scenarios such as merging, remuxing, and subtitle embedding, ensuring the correct file is identified even if the tracked path is invalid or missing.
